Usage
Building
To build locally, run colmena apply-local as root.
To build the remote machines, run colmena apply. See the colmena documentation for command-line options. Notable options include:
--on [hostname]: build a specific machine only--reboot: reboot after building (but note this bug means it may hang even when the reboot completes successfully)
